应用程序为什么发生异常

时间:2025-01-29 23:11:07 手机游戏

应用程序发生异常的原因多种多样,可以从以下几个方面进行分析:

软件bug

代码错误:程序代码中可能存在逻辑错误、空指针引用、数组越界等编程错误,这些错误可能导致程序在运行过程中出现异常,从而崩溃。

兼容性问题:应用程序可能与用户的手机操作系统版本、硬件设备等不兼容,导致在某些设备上无法正常运行。

更新问题:应用程序的更新可能会引入新的bug或不兼容问题,导致崩溃。

系统环境变化

系统文件损坏或丢失:应用程序完整的运行需要一些系统文件或者某些库文件支持,如果这些文件缺失或损坏,可能导致应用程序异常。

操作系统自身的问题:电脑Windows操作系统本身也会有BUG,会与软件不兼容,导致未知的软件异常。

硬件问题

资源不足:如果手机的内存、CPU、存储空间等资源不足,可能会导致应用程序无法正常运行,甚至崩溃。

硬件故障:手机的硬件出现故障,如内存损坏、CPU故障等,也可能导致应用程序崩溃。

网络问题

网络连接不稳定:网络连接不稳定或网速太慢,应用程序可能会出现无法加载数据、请求超时、页面加载缓慢等问题。

用户操作问题

不当操作:用户在使用应用程序时,可能会进行一些不当的操作,如同时打开多个应用程序、频繁切换应用程序等,这些操作可能会导致应用程序出现异常,从而崩溃。

软件冲突

软件不兼容:当两个软件不兼容时,同时运行时就可能造成应用程序发生异常。

组件丢失或损坏:应用程序的组件丢失或损坏也可能导致应用程序异常。

解决方法

更新软件:

确保应用程序和操作系统都是最新版本,以修复已知的问题和漏洞。

检查系统文件:

修复或重新安装丢失或损坏的系统文件。

检查硬件:

确保硬件设备正常运行,清理灰尘,检查内存条等硬件组件。

优化网络连接:

确保网络连接稳定,避免在网络不稳定时进行敏感操作。

避免软件冲突:

卸载可能引起冲突的软件,确保应用程序之间有足够的兼容性。

增强安全性:

安装杀毒软件,定期进行全盘扫描和病毒查杀。

通过以上方法,可以有效地减少应用程序异常的发生,提高用户体验和应用程序的稳定性。